WORK is continuing to dismantle a well known feature of Bolton's skyline.
The National Grid is currently removing gas holders on Spa Road as part of a national programme to regenerate old sites and put them to more productive use in the future.
The project is well underway and two gas holders are being taken down from the site which is the historic home of Bolton's gas supply.The Bolton Gas Light and Coke Co was first formed in 1818, and a small site works was built in Forge Street, later known as Gas Street.
The site at Gas Street later became the main gas making works in Bolton. In 1886 a major reconstruction took place at the works, and adjoining land was acquired in order to expand. Until 1926, work was taking place to develop and improve the site at Gas Street, which supplied gas across Bolton.
